Abstract

PURPOSE: To prevent lowering of percentage of content of noncharging particles such as a pigment, etc., in a formed paint film, by making a paint flow along a metallic material in its advancing direction, at the same speed as the advancing speed, in case of electrodeposition painting of the metallic material.
CONSTITUTION: In an electrodeposition bath 1, a liquid flow providing device 6 which consists of an insulator such as a vinyl chloride cylinder 6a, etc., and has provided in parallel plural jet nozzles 6a directed in the advancing direction of a metallic plate 3, on its tip, around a place where the metallic plate 3 advances between electrode plates 5. From said each jet nozzle 6b, an electrodeposition paint 2 is jetted and is made to flow along the metallic plate 3. A flow-out speed from the jet nozzle 6b is adjusted so that a speed of the paint 2 after this jetting and a shifting speed of the metallic plate 3 become within about 0.4m/sec. Also, this constitution is made so that the flow becomes a laminar flow state between the metallic plate 3 and the electrode plate 5, and also it flows at a uniform speed in the width direction. In this way, it is possible to make the paint containing the noncharging particles of a prescribed quantity, and electrodeposition painting can be performed at a high speed.
